在软件项目管理中,项目需求确认是确保项目成功的关键环节之一。它涉及到对项目需求的全面理解、详细记录和有效沟通。以下是进行项目需求确认的详细步骤和方法。

一、明确项目目标和范围

在进行项目需求确认之前,首先要明确项目的目标和范围。这包括:

  1. 项目目标:明确项目要实现的具体功能和性能指标。
  2. 项目范围:界定项目的工作边界,包括项目包含的工作内容和排除的工作内容。

二、收集需求信息

  1. 与利益相关者沟通:与项目干系人(如客户、项目经理、开发团队、测试人员等)进行沟通,了解他们的需求和期望。
  2. 分析现有系统:如果项目是对现有系统的升级或改进,需要分析现有系统的功能和性能,找出需要改进的地方。
  3. 市场调研:了解同类产品的功能和性能,分析竞争对手的优势和劣势。

三、整理需求文档

  1. 编写需求规格说明书:详细记录项目的功能需求、性能需求、界面需求、安全性需求等。
  2. 确保需求文档的完整性:需求文档应包含所有需求点,避免遗漏。
  3. 确保需求文档的可读性:使用清晰、简洁的语言,避免使用过于专业化的术语。

四、需求评审

  1. 组织需求评审会议:邀请项目干系人参加,对需求文档进行评审。
  2. 评审内容:评审需求文档的完整性、准确性、可行性、一致性等。
  3. 汇总评审意见:记录评审过程中发现的问题和改进建议。

五、需求确认

  1. 评审后的需求确认:在需求评审会议结束后,由项目经理组织项目干系人进行需求确认。
  2. 确认方式:可以通过以下方式确认需求:
    a. 逐条确认:逐条阅读需求文档,确保所有需求点都被确认。
    b. 交叉确认:将需求点与其他干系人进行交叉确认,确保需求的一致性。
    c. 签字确认:将确认后的需求文档打印出来,让项目干系人签字确认。

六、需求变更管理

  1. 制定需求变更管理流程:明确需求变更的提出、审批、实施和监控等环节。
  2. 建立需求变更记录:记录所有需求变更的内容、原因、时间等信息。
  3. 评估需求变更对项目的影响:对需求变更进行评估,分析其对项目进度、成本、质量等方面的影响。

七、持续跟踪和沟通

  1. 定期召开项目需求会议:与项目干系人保持沟通,了解他们的需求和期望。
  2. 针对需求变更及时调整:根据需求变更调整需求文档,确保项目需求的准确性。
  3. 及时反馈项目进展:将项目进展情况及时反馈给项目干系人,让他们了解项目的实施情况。

总之,进行项目需求确认是软件项目管理中的重要环节。通过以上步骤和方法,可以确保项目需求的准确性和一致性,提高项目成功率。在实际操作过程中,项目经理和团队成员应注重沟通、协作,共同努力实现项目目标。

猜你喜欢:好用的项目管理工具